Etymology

edit

First attested as holensloot in 1343. Compound of an inflected form of Middle Dutch hol (low-lying, deep, swampy) and sloot (ditch).

Proper noun

edit

Holysloot n

  1. A village and former municipality of Amsterdam, Noord-Holland, Netherlands.
